All lots marked with an asterisk (*) in this catalogue are most likely exempt from any US import tariffs, as they have been exported from the United States within the last 3 years and should be able to be returned under HTSUS subheading 9801.00.10. We have consulted a leading U.S. law firm specialised in International Trade who confirmed that in principle this is possible, but highlighting the lack of rulings in the specific context of ancient coins sold at auction. Hopefully, we will have some clarity by the time of the auction. Should you have any questions in the meantime, please do not hesitate to contact one of our offices.

Greek Coins Bruttium, Croton

Nomos circa 530-500, AR 28 mm, 7.8 g. [koppa]PO Tripod, legs terminating in lion's feet. Rev. Same type incuse. SNG ANS 238-241. de Luynes 712. AMB 194. Jameson 417. Historia Numorum Italy 2075.
Wonderful old cabinet tone and about extremely fine

Ex Spink & Son Numismatic Circular 77, 1969, 9. From the Collection of Jacqueline Morineau Humphris.
